All 4 of my daughters graduated from North High. I was usually very secure with their safety at school. For the last few years, North has had 2 very good principals (Wren and Padgett) who have been very familiar and supportive of the students personally. They attend most of the school functions which the previous principal did not. North is like small town schools used to be before they became overcrowded and overly competitive in sports. With very little cutting, just about any student can participate in anything they want to. Sometimes, being able to belong is as important as grades.

THis school has improved when it comes to more student graduating, and theres is more security, we have good Bio Med program for those who want to have a career in the Medical field, an Auto Tech program for thouse who would like to be engeneers or Mechanics, there is also an AVID program for those students that are eligible to earn good grades but are not this program helps them earn the grades that they are capable of earning.
